ASP.NET Core WebAPI 开发-新建WebAPI项目
2016-05-16 11:53
1181 查看
ASP.NET Core WebAPI 开发-新建WebAPI项目,
ASP.NET Core 1.0 RC2 即将发布,我们现在来学习一下 ASP.NET Core WebAPI开发。
网上已经有泄露的VS2015 Tooling,需要VS2015 Update 2。
.NET Core 1.0.0 RC2 SDK Preview1 win64 http://download.microsoft.com/download/2/1/0/2107669A-0DF9-4A91-A275-74735D433045/dotnet-dev-win-x64.1.0.0-preview1-002702.zip
WinSvr Hosting https://download.microsoft.com/download/4/6/1/46116DFF-29F9-4FF8-94BF-F9BE05BE263B/DotNetCore.1.0.0.RC2-WindowsHosting.exe
VS2015 Tooling https://download.microsoft.com/download/4/6/1/46116DFF-29F9-4FF8-94BF-F9BE05BE263B/DotNetCore.1.0.0.RC2-VS2015Tools.Preview1.exe
我也在第一时间安装上了,终于可以使用VS 开发 .NET Core 应用程序了。
安装好VS2015 Tooling 以后,我们在新建项目里就可以选择 .NET Core 。
View Code
这里的路由是直接写在Controller 里。
程序运行起来访问:http://localhost:5000/api/users
http://localhost:5000/api/users/1
开发 ASP.NET Core 应用程序,还是VS好用。之前用VS Code 总有些不适应。
下一篇:ASP.NET Core 开发 - EntityFrameworkCore
如果你觉得本文对你有帮助,请点击“推荐”,谢谢。
ASP.NET Core 1.0 RC2 即将发布,我们现在来学习一下 ASP.NET Core WebAPI开发。
网上已经有泄露的VS2015 Tooling,需要VS2015 Update 2。
.NET Core 1.0.0 RC2 SDK Preview1 win64 http://download.microsoft.com/download/2/1/0/2107669A-0DF9-4A91-A275-74735D433045/dotnet-dev-win-x64.1.0.0-preview1-002702.zip
WinSvr Hosting https://download.microsoft.com/download/4/6/1/46116DFF-29F9-4FF8-94BF-F9BE05BE263B/DotNetCore.1.0.0.RC2-WindowsHosting.exe
VS2015 Tooling https://download.microsoft.com/download/4/6/1/46116DFF-29F9-4FF8-94BF-F9BE05BE263B/DotNetCore.1.0.0.RC2-VS2015Tools.Preview1.exe
我也在第一时间安装上了,终于可以使用VS 开发 .NET Core 应用程序了。
安装好VS2015 Tooling 以后,我们在新建项目里就可以选择 .NET Core 。
新建WebAPI项目
新建项目[Route("api/[controller]")] public class UsersController : Controller { // GET: api/values [HttpGet] public IEnumerable<string> Get() { return new string[] { "linezero", "cnblogs" }; } // GET api/values/5 [HttpGet("{id}")] public string Get(int id) { return $"linezero-{id}"; } }
View Code
这里的路由是直接写在Controller 里。
[Route("api/[controller]")]
程序运行起来访问:http://localhost:5000/api/users
http://localhost:5000/api/users/1
开发 ASP.NET Core 应用程序,还是VS好用。之前用VS Code 总有些不适应。
下一篇:ASP.NET Core 开发 - EntityFrameworkCore
如果你觉得本文对你有帮助,请点击“推荐”,谢谢。
相关文章推荐
- Spring基础知识(7)-Aspectj
- 在ASP.NET 2.0中操作数据之五十二:使用FileUpload上传文件
- asp.net web 开发登录相关操作的控件LoginName、LoginStatus和LoginView控件使用详解
- asp.net 微信支付 错误解决方案
- Spring AOP @AspectJ 入门基础
- 转载 asp.net的Request.ServerVariables参数说明
- 在ASP.NET 2.0中操作数据之五十一:从GridView的页脚插入新记录
- 在ASP.NET 2.0中操作数据之五十:为GridView控件添加Checkbox
- .Net中导出数据到Excel(asp.net和winform程序中)
- raspberry树莓派安装CUPS实现打印服务器共享HP P1007打印机
- C# ASP.NET FILEUPLOAD详解
- 在ASP.NET 2.0中操作数据之四十九:为GridView控件添加RadioButton
- 在ASP.NET 2.0中操作数据之四十八:对SqlDataSource控件使用开放式并发
- IdeaSpace安装
- asp.net4.5尚未在web服务器上注册 解决方案
- 利用记事本创建一个ASP.NET Core RC2 MVC应用
- 在ASP.NET 2.0中操作数据之四十八:对SqlDataSource控件使用开放式并发
- 在ASP.NET 2.0中操作数据之四十九:为GridView控件添加RadioButton
- 在ASP.NET 2.0中操作数据之五十:为GridView控件添加Checkbox
- 在ASP.NET 2.0中操作数据之五十一:从GridView的页脚插入新记录